KEY POSITION SPECIFIC ROLES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Participates in the day to day operations of the department.
Ensures completion of repairs to the physical plant and all equipment not covered by outside service contracts in accordance with blueprints, operation manual and manufacturers specifications.
Performs preventative maintenance on all equipment.
Responsible for painting, salt, sanding and shoveling of the grounds.
Installs, replaces, repairs and calibrates pneumatic control systems, thermostats, receiver-controller, modulation valves and damper motors.
Use TELS maintenance program to determine what needs to be repaired.
Able to mix chemicals according to the manufacturer recommendations and with the use of safety equipment.
Check stock supplies as needed and see what items are available within budget.
Respond to inquiries relating to particular area or to requests from members, visitors, other personnel within given periods.
Attends all mandatory in-services annually.
Repairs rooms, as required, to accommodate new admissions.
Ensures the appearance of the facility if neat and clean.
Follows safety guidelines and trainings to prevent work injuries.
Performs other duties as assigned by Supervisor.

MINIMUM JOB REQUIREMENTS
High School diploma or equivalent
One to two (1-2) years experience in building maintenance.
Valid drivers license
Flexible work schedule (mornings, afternoons, nights, weekends, holidays, etc.) which may include beyond eight hours in a day, 40 hours in a week.
Follows all attendance policies and procedures, including punctuality and proper timeclock or timesheet reporting.
Compliance with infectious disease policies and procedures related to, but not limited to tuberculosis screening of health-care workers.
